cold war

英 [ˌkəʊld ˈwɔː(r)]

美 [ˌkoʊld ˈwɔːr]

n.  冷战(通常指第二次世界大战后美国与苏联之间的对峙局面)

法律

Collins.2

牛津词典

    noun

    • 冷战(通常指第二次世界大战后美国与苏联之间的对峙局面)
      a very unfriendly relationship between two countries who are not actually fighting each other, usually used about the situation between the US and the Soviet Union after the Second World War

      柯林斯词典

      • N-PROPER (二战后开始的)冷战
        The Cold Warwas the period of hostility and tension between the Soviet bloc and the Western powers that followed the Second World War.
        1. ...the end of the cold war and the decline in armaments spending.
          冷战的结束和军备开支的减少
        2. ...the first major crisis of the post-Cold War era.
          冷战后第一次重大的危机

      英英释义

      noun

      • a state of political hostility between countries using means short of armed warfare
